Consolidation Merger
The combination of two or more companies into a completely new entity, with the original companies ceasing to exist.
Congeneric Merger
A type of merger between companies in related industries or sectors, aimed at diversification or enhancing competitive strengths.
Horizontal Merger
A business consolidation that occurs between firms operating in the same industry, often as competitors.
Vertical Merger
A merger between two companies that operate at different stages of the production process for a specific finished product.
